René Koechlin

René Koechlin was a Franco-Swiss engineer, specialised in the production of electricity by hydraulic power.

René Koechlin was also a traveller, painter and art collector.

Date and place of birt:4 august 1866, Buhl, France
Date and place of death:30 june 1951, Blonay, Switzerland
Nationality:France, Switzerland
Period of activity: XIX, XX century
Specialization:Engineer
